Abstract:
The ability to achieve asymmetric synthesis and the development of strategies for the synthesis of complex molecules are among the frontiers of organic synthesis. On the other hand, the total synthesis of natural products has always been a hot topic among natural product chemists. In this lecture, we will summarize the progress in asymmetric catalytic reactions and the total synthesis of natural products.
Lecturer's Profile:
Professor Shao Zhihui, Ph.D., is a doctoral supervisor, a national high-level talent, and the dean of the Graduate School of Yunnan University. He obtained his Ph.D. from Lanzhou University in 2004, and from 2004 to 2006, he conducted postdoctoral research at the University of Montreal in Canada. From 2006 to 2007, he was a postdoctoral researcher at the Hong Kong University of Science and Technology. From 2014 to 2015, he was a senior researcher at Stanford University in the United States. In September 2007, he joined Yunnan University as an independent researcher. His main research interests include asymmetric synthesis and the total synthesis of natural products. In 2022, he received the First Prize of Yunnan Provincial Natural Science, and the Baogang Outstanding Teacher Award in the same year. In 2016, he received the First Prize of Yunnan Provincial Outstanding Contribution to Professional and Technical Talents, and the Thieme Chemistry Journals Award in Germany. In 2010, he was selected for the New Century Talent Support Program by the Ministry of Education.
